你查询的IP:[124.220.93.59]  地理位置:中国–上海–上海

最新查询114.54.26.219 117.76.154.114 116.8.32.117 123.244.163.204 121.32.162.119 121.16.30.88 119.108.65.16 218.245.69.2 118.180.228.33 124.220.93.59 117.60.46.180 118.192.31.20 116.248.243.94 119.78.195.84 120.24.152.245 120.92.67.47 118.112.219.80 117.60.178.14 203.90.128.109 218.64.202.201 123.232.174.32 58.66.138.146 119.8.28.114 116.244.39.75 61.232.11.149 58.240.204.188 221.208.25.104 58.82.25.49 117.121.128.71 122.102.131.25 202.10.64.219